How to compose a reflection paper?

A reflection paper is a written piece that explores your personal thoughts and feelings about a particular subject. In a reflection paper, you can discuss your thoughts and emotions about an experience, event, or statement. You can also reflect on what you’ve learned from a course, book, or article. A reflection paper is your opportunity to share your thoughts and feelings about a topic.

There is no one answer to this question as it will depend on the purpose of the reflection paper and the specific instructions given by the teacher or instructor. However, there are some general tips that can be followed when writing a reflection paper. It is important to first read and understand the prompt or question that is being asked, as this will help to guide the content of the paper. Once the purpose of the paper is clear, it is important to brainstorm and organize thoughts and ideas before beginning to write. When writing the paper, it is important to focus on personal thoughts and feelings in order to create a sincere and genuine reflection. The paper should be written in first person and should be concise and clear. After the paper is written, it is important to proofread and edit for grammar and spelling errors.

How do you write a reflection paper?

A reflection paper is a common type of academic writing, which requires careful planning and analysis. In order to write a good reflection paper, follow these 8 steps:

1. Understand and summarize the material
2. Analyze the material
3. Select a theme
4. Make connections between your opinions and the material
5. Begin with an introduction
6. Write the body of the paper
7. End with a good conclusion
8. Proofread and edit

There are a few things to keep in mind when starting a reflection paper:

1. Always start with a strong thesis statement or a list of lessons you have learned.

2. Since your purpose is to reflect, it is crucial to talk about how the author’s writing has influenced you and what you think about it.

3. Use descriptive language to explain your feelings and thoughts.

4. Be honest and open-minded in your reflection.

What makes a good reflective essay?

When writing a reflective essay, it is important to ensure that the body of the essay is well focused and contains appropriate critique and reflection. The body should not only summarise your experience, but should also explore the impact that the experience has had on your life, as well as the lessons that you have learned as a result. By doing this, you will provide a well-rounded and insightful reflection that will be of value to both yourself and others.
